(Davenport, IA) -- The owner of a Davenport apartment building that partially collapsed nearly two years ago killing three men and leaving dozens homeless will not face criminal charges.
Scott County Attorney Kelly Cunningham says the Iowa Division of Criminal Investigation found no evidence that would warrant charges. She says Andrew Wold hadn't owned the 120 year-old building for very long at the time of the collapse, and that he hadn't neglected its condition.
Cunningham says she's been concerned for the safety of Wold and city staff who have received threats over the collapse. The decision doesn't affect the civil lawsuits against Wold, contractors and the city of Davenport.
